“The Three Hierarchs, Priors of Truth and Fear of God”

Jan 31, 2020 | 11:41
in Carousel Front Page, Church of Cyprus
“The Three Hierarchs, Priors of Truth and Fear of God”

Photo credit: Church of Cyprus

The annual established event for the feast of the Three Hierarchs and Protectors of Greek Letters and Education, Basil the Great, Gregory the Theologian and John Chrysostom was organized this year too. The whole event took place on the afternoon of Thursday, January 30, 2020, at the event hall of the Archbishop Makarios III Cultural Foundation in Nicosia.

Metropolitan Vasilios of Constantia and Famagusta, the Bishops Christoforos of Karpasia and Grigorios of Mesaoria, the Chief Secretary of the Holy Synod of the Church of Cyprus, Archimandrite Gregory Mousouroulis were present.

The keynote address was given by Metropolitan Vasilios of Constantia and Famagusta, Professor of the Theological School of the Church of Cyprus, on “The Theory of Being: The Goals of Education”.

Praising the struggles, lives, work and the theology of the Three Hierarchs, the Metropolitan, while comparing their high level of education with the education we offer today, addressing parents and teachers, emphasized the need to offer children and young people not only tangible goods that are easily scattered, but also spiritual and consistent ones. He also urged parents not to subordinate their children’s intellectual and cognitive education.

Bishop Christoforos of Karpasia addressed the final greeting on behalf of the Archbishop of Cyprus, stating that according to Saint John the Chrysostom, “Education is the communion of holiness”. That is, education is to obtain holiness which means quality spiritual and mental cultivation through education and education.
